Transaction 82d502f7b13dc6efe91d3c5fd83fe1e181e62e2c86f88e95f3fcc206817d0ad3

2 Input
1 Outputs
  • 82d502f7b13dc6efe91d3c5fd83fe1e181e62e2c86f88e95f3fcc206817d0ad3:0
  • value  3076775
    address  17FKP7649BkjHZEbqaKS5pA6JMChAwW8c5